CNC Machinist Mill II, CNC Milling & Machining
Overview
You will own the production of precision milled components for commercial, aerospace, and government clients at Athena Manufacturing's Austin facility. You'll program, set up, and run CNC Mills to hold tight tolerances, working with M2M and SFM systems. You'll join a team that values 2 Second Lean continuous improvement, where your ideas shape daily operations. This role stands out for its clear growth path and commitment to employee training.
What You'll Do8
- 1Read work orders and blueprints to determine product specs and material needs.
- 2Set up and operate CNC Mills, lathes, and grinders to machine parts to exact specifications.
- 3Mount tools, fixtures, and materials, then align and secure them for precise cutting.
- 4Calculate dimensions and tolerances using micrometers and calipers to verify conformance.
- 5Monitor machine feed and speed during runs to catch flaws and adjust as needed.
- 6Sharpen cutting and grinding tools to maintain performance.
- 7Maintain a clean, safe work area and follow all safety protocols, including wearing PPE.
- 8Support 2 Second Lean initiatives by identifying daily improvements in your work cell.
